In a recent incident involving a hacked X account of Milwaukee Mitchell International Airport, the Hoda Law Firm has taken steps to distance itself from the situation. The firm has issued a statement clarifying its non-involvement and addressing the misuse of its name by scammers. The source reports that the firm is actively working to mitigate any potential damage to its reputation.

Concerns Over Reputation Exploitation

Marshal Hoda, the owner of the Hoda Law Firm, expressed concern over the exploitation of their reputation by fraudsters aiming to deceive victims. He emphasized that the firm is not associated with the hacking incident and is actively working to protect its clients and the public from such scams.

Measures to Safeguard Reputation

To further safeguard their reputation, the firm has placed a warning on their homepage, alerting visitors to the ongoing impersonation and advising them to remain vigilant.
